7. Reports
7.A. Student Board Representative
Danielle Hubbard
Discussion

Danielle discussed the senior projects. They held a Haunted House fundraiser on October 24th at the Dayton YMCA and raised $687. This money will go towards Christmas presents for students at LES. She also noted that PBIS and 10 for 10's are still going well.

7.B. DHS Principal's Report
Jeremy Dodd
Attachments
Discussion

Mr. Dodd introduced Julie Rubemeyer who did a PowerPoint presentation on Literacy and the Read 180 program. One highlight from her presentation is that 59% of students in Read 180 improved their Lexile score from 2014 to 2015 on the SRI assessment.

7.E. Attendance/Energy Management/Student Services/Transportation
Ron Kinmon
Attachments
Discussion

Mr. Kinmon noted that enrollment is going back up. He also mentioned that there has been a trend in the area this year with more kids being homeschooled, which is hurting enrollment.
